Species that contain: Amphipnous and cuchia [ 1 ] records

cuchia, Unibranchapertura Hamilton [F.] 1822:16, 363, Pl. 16 (fig. 4) [An account of the fishes found in the river Ganges; ref. 2031] Southeastern Bengal, India. No types known. Spelled cachia by Cuvier 1829:354 [ref. 995]. Hamilton's original illustration reproduced by Britz 2019:Pl. 9 [ref. 37532] •Valid as Amphipnous cuchia (Hamilton 1822) -- (Shrestha 1978:40 [ref. 15970]). •Valid as Monopterus cuchia (Hamilton 1822) -- (Rosen & Greenwood 1976:59 [ref. 7094], Ataur Rahman 1989:50 [ref. 24860], Talwar & Jhingran 1991:776 [ref. 20764], Sen 1995:583 [ref. 23778], Zhu 1995:168 [ref. 25213], Banik & Choudhury 1996:579 [ref. 24736], Bailey & Gans 1998:6 [ref. 23296], Menon 1999:280 [ref. 24904], Rafique 2000:327 [ref. 25220], Karmakar 2000:34 [ref. 25662], Gopi 2002:139 [ref. 27553], Ataur Rahman 2003:65 [ref. 31338], Shrestha 2008:208 [ref. 29923], Britz et al. 2011:57 [ref. 31404], Kottelat 2013:308 [ref. 32989], Zhang et al. 2016:192 [ref. 34477], Britz et al. 2016:321 [ref. 34914], Kosygin et al. 2022:670 [ref. 40736], Tudu et al. 2022:43 [ref. 40484]). •Valid as Ophichthys cuchia (Hamilton 1822) -- (Britz et al. 2020:14 [ref. 37335], Best et al. 2022:477 [ref. 39249], Britz et al. 2023:14 [ref. 40009], Chan et al. 2023:140 [ref. 40365], Page et al. 2023:126 [ref. 40505]). Current status: Valid as Ophichthys cuchia (Hamilton 1822). Synbranchidae. Distribution: South Asia: Pakistan, India, Nepal, Bangladesh, Myanmar and ?China. Introduced in Texas (U.S.A.) and Hong Kong (China). Habitat: freshwater, brackish.
